Description

Jason Forrester, a middle-aged TechShack owner and lifelong tinkerer, is days away from closing his store for good. As he inventories old gadgets and fends off corporate shutdown notices, he begins detecting strange radio signals through his HAM setup, messages encoded in Morse, 80s TV themes, and modem screeches. He teams up with Jennifer, a conspiracy podcast host, and Chad, a sarcastic teenage tech whiz, to decode the signal.

The signal leads to revelations hidden in Jason's garage, once his father's domain, suggesting something alien or extradimensional is trying to make contact, possibly through old tech. As they investigate, they're tailed by mysterious government agents and watched by strangers buying up vintage components.

The trio eventually activates a portal using a makeshift machine assembled from Jason’s father’s prototype and nostalgic relics. They drive Jason’s MR2 through the rift and enter a surreal alternate world made of obsolete tech, a digital afterlife of forgotten electronics. There, Jason learns the world is failing, and only someone who understands analog tech and forgotten codes can fix it.
